Common Caution Lighting and Meanings



When it comes to driving your car, recognizing common caution lights and their significances is vital for your safety and security and vehicle upkeep. Here are a few usual caution lights you may experience:

1. ** Check Engine Light **: This light shows a problem with your engine. Maybe something small like a loose gas cap or something more serious like engine misfiring.

2. ** Battery Light **: This light signals a trouble with your car's charging system. It might suggest a faulty battery, generator, or other related elements.

3. ** Oil Pressure Light **: When this light begins, it suggests your engine may be running low on oil or experiencing reduced oil stress, which can bring about engine damage otherwise dealt with promptly.

4. ** Brake System Light **: This light suggests a concern with your stopping system. It could suggest reduced brake fluid degrees or an issue with the brake system that requires prompt focus.

Comprehending these typical caution lights will help you recognize possible problems early and prevent more substantial troubles later on.
